It looks like it is time for winter dormancy for the plants again. The Dionaea are definitely looking less active with slower growth and more dead leaves. Strangely, a couple of them started to put up flower stalks, which I quickly removed.

The traps of my Sarracenia have started to die back, with little new growth, but the Drosera are still looking fine as expected, though they are definitely growing more slowly than before.
